Country: Switzerland, Mint: Swiss Bullion Corp AG, Diameter: 32.00mm, Thickness: 2.05mm, Weight: 31.10g, Purity: 999.9% (24 karat), Finish: High Proof, ISIN No.: XD0224490314
Limited Edition Islamic Gold Collection, the coin comes in a presentation case and certificate of authencity from the Swiss refinery.

The round ingot bears the hallmark of the Swiss foundry "ESSAYEUR FONDEUR", along with the weight and purity.
The obverse design on the round demonstrates the celestial vault and the moon crescent, featuring in some combination form the basis of symbols widely found across the ancient world. This is the symbol of Islam or the Muslim community today. On the bottom we have the inscriptions "1 oz. Au 999.9" confirming the weight, the metal and the fineness of the metal, followed by the three Swiss hallmarks: Founder/Assayer - Engraver – and the Swiss Bullion Corp Responsibility Mark. Finally the year 2013 from the lunar calendar.
The reverse design. In the center, a calligraphy of Eid Mubarak. This is a traditional Muslim greeting reserved for use on the festivals of Eid ul-Adha and Eid ul-Fitr. Eid refers to the occasion itself, and Mubarak means "Blessed." This exchange of greetings is a cultural tradition and not part of any religious obligation. Around the calligraphy, a traditional geometric figure representing the Doors of Jannah, the eight doors to Heaven in the Islamic tradition.
